components/lighttpd/patches/lighttpd-conf_file.patch
changeset 331 5001b63ddc8a
child 2934 ed4c692fa932
--- /dev/null	Thu Jan 01 00:00:00 1970 +0000
+++ b/components/lighttpd/patches/lighttpd-conf_file.patch	Wed Jun 22 14:10:22 2011 -0700
@@ -0,0 +1,114 @@
+--- doc/lighttpd.conf-orig	Thu Apr  9 13:02:00 2009
++++ doc/lighttpd.conf	Wed Nov  4 03:16:09 2009
+@@ -36,10 +36,10 @@
+ 
+ ## A static document-root. For virtual hosting take a look at the
+ ## mod_simple_vhost module.
+-server.document-root        = "/srv/www/htdocs/"
++server.document-root = "/var/lighttpd/1.4/docroot"
+ 
+ ## where to send error-messages to
+-server.errorlog             = "/var/log/lighttpd/error.log"
++server.errorlog = "/var/lighttpd/1.4/logs/error.log"
+ 
+ # files to check for if .../ is requested
+ index-file.names            = ( "index.php", "index.html",
+@@ -46,8 +46,10 @@
+                                 "index.htm", "default.htm" )
+ 
+ ## set the event-handler (read the performance section in the manual)
+-# server.event-handler = "freebsd-kqueue" # needed on OS X
++server.event-handler = "solaris-devpoll"
++server.network-backend = "writev"
+ 
++
+ # mimetype mapping
+ mimetype.assign             = (
+   ".pdf"          =>      "application/pdf",
+@@ -115,7 +117,7 @@
+ # server.tag                 = "lighttpd"
+ 
+ #### accesslog module
+-accesslog.filename          = "/var/log/lighttpd/access.log"
++accesslog.filename = "/var/lighttpd/1.4/logs/access.log"
+ 
+ ## deny access the file-extensions
+ #
+@@ -147,7 +149,7 @@
+ #server.error-handler-404   = "/error-handler.php"
+ 
+ ## to help the rc.scripts
+-#server.pid-file            = "/var/run/lighttpd.pid"
++server.pid-file = "/var/run/lighttpd14.pid"
+ 
+ 
+ ###### virtual hosts
+@@ -160,7 +162,7 @@
+ ## or
+ ##   virtual-server-root + http-host + virtual-server-docroot
+ ##
+-#simple-vhost.server-root   = "/srv/www/vhosts/"
++#simple-vhost.server-root   = "/var/lighttpd/1.4/vhosts/"
+ #simple-vhost.default-host  = "www.example.org"
+ #simple-vhost.document-root = "/htdocs/"
+ 
+@@ -168,8 +170,7 @@
+ ##
+ ## Format: <errorfile-prefix><status-code>.html
+ ## -> ..../status-404.html for 'File not found'
+-#server.errorfile-prefix    = "/usr/share/lighttpd/errors/status-"
+-#server.errorfile-prefix    = "/srv/www/errors/status-"
++#server.errorfile-prefix    = "/var/lighttpd/1.4/errors/status-"
+ 
+ ## virtual directory listings
+ #dir-listing.activate       = "enable"
+@@ -188,10 +189,10 @@
+ #server.chroot              = "/"
+ 
+ ## change uid to <uid> (default: don't care)
+-#server.username            = "wwwrun"
++server.username = "webservd"
+ 
+ ## change uid to <uid> (default: don't care)
+-#server.groupname           = "wwwrun"
++server.groupname           = "webservd"
+ 
+ #### compress module
+ #compress.cache-dir         = "/var/cache/lighttpd/compress/"
+@@ -214,8 +215,8 @@
+ #fastcgi.server             = ( ".php" =>
+ #                               ( "localhost" =>
+ #                                 (
+-#                                   "socket" => "/var/run/lighttpd/php-fastcgi.socket",
+-#                                   "bin-path" => "/usr/local/bin/php-cgi"
++#                                   "socket" => "/tmp/lighttpd/php-fastcgi.socket",
++#                                   "bin-path" => "/usr/php/bin/php-cgi"
+ #                                 )
+ #                               )
+ #                            )
+@@ -274,7 +275,7 @@
+ # %3 => subdomain 1 name
+ # %4 => subdomain 2 name
+ #
+-#evhost.path-pattern        = "/srv/www/vhosts/%3/htdocs/"
++#evhost.path-pattern        = "/var/lighttpd/1.4/vhosts/%3/htdocs/"
+ 
+ #### expire module
+ #expire.url                 = ( "/buggy/" => "access 2 hours", "/asdhas/" => "access plus 1 seconds 2 minutes")
+@@ -312,8 +313,8 @@
+ #index-file.names += (foo + ".php")
+ 
+ #### include
+-#include /etc/lighttpd/lighttpd-inc.conf
+-## same as above if you run: "lighttpd -f /etc/lighttpd/lighttpd.conf"
++#include /etc/lighttpd/1.4/lighttpd-inc.conf
++## same as above if you run: "lighttpd -f /etc/lighttpd/1.4/lighttpd.conf"
+ #include "lighttpd-inc.conf"
+ 
+ #### include_shell
+@@ -320,3 +321,5 @@
+ #include_shell "echo var.a=1"
+ ## the above is same as:
+ #var.a=1
++# Set the directory used for file uploads to /tmp
++server.upload-dirs = ( "/tmp" )